VNAM vs VYM Performance

Global X MSCI Vietnam ETF (VNAM) is an ETF from Global X by mirae Asset and Vanguard High Dividend Yield ETF (VYM) is an ETF from Vanguard (US). Over the past year VNAM returned +12.23% while VYM returned +17.82%. Year to date, VNAM is down 0.84% versus a gain of 13.15% for VYM.

Over three years, VNAM compounded at +11.30% per year against +17.99% for VYM.

Risk: Volatility and Drawdowns

VNAM has been the more volatile fund, with annualized monthly volatility of 25.1% compared with 13.6% for VYM. Lower volatility generally means a smoother ride, though it often comes with lower long-run returns.

The deepest peak-to-trough decline in our data was -52.8% for VNAM and -15.8% for VYM. Drawdown depth is what each fund did in the worst stretch of the window measured above.

The two funds' monthly returns correlate at 0.43. They move together some of the time, and apart the rest.

Fees and Cost Over Time

VNAM charges 0.51% per year while VYM charges 0.04%. On a $10,000 position that is $51 vs $4 annually, a gap of $47 per year that compounds over a long holding period. On income, VNAM currently yields 0.48% against 2.22% for VYM.
